Crawlspace Repair in Columbus, OH
Crawlspace repair services focus on addressing issues beneath a home’s main living area, including problems like moisture intrusion, mold growth, wood rot, and structural damage. These projects typically involve inspecting and fixing foundation problems, installing vapor barriers, sealing vents, and repairing or replacing damaged supports. Homeowners often seek crawlspace repairs to improve indoor air quality, prevent pest infestations, and protect the home's foundation from further deterioration.
Before requesting crawlspace repair services, property owners should understand the specific issues affecting their crawlspace, such as signs of water damage, musty odors, or visible mold. It’s also helpful to know the extent of any structural damage and whether moisture control measures are needed. Clear communication about the existing conditions and desired outcomes can assist in determining the most appropriate solutions for maintaining a safe and stable home environment.

Common Crawlspace Repair Jobs
Crawlspace Encapsulation - sealing the crawlspace to prevent moisture and humidity issues.
Foundation Vent Repair - fixing or sealing vents to improve airflow and reduce water intrusion.
Moisture Barrier Installation - installing vapor barriers to control ground moisture and improve indoor air quality.
Crawlspace Insulation - adding insulation to improve energy efficiency and prevent drafts.
Structural Repair - addressing sagging or damaged supports to ensure a stable foundation.
Waterproofing Solutions - applying waterproof coatings to protect against water seepage and flooding.
Crawlspace Repair Questions
What are common signs of crawlspace damage? Indicators include musty odors, mold growth, visible pest activity, or uneven flooring above the crawlspace area.
Why is it important to repair a crawlspace? Repairing prevents structural issues, reduces moisture problems, and improves indoor air quality in the home.
What types of repair services are available for crawlspaces? Services include moisture barrier installation, foundation stabilization, pest remediation, and insulation upgrades.
Is crawlspace repair necessary for all homes? Not all homes require repairs, but addressing issues proactively can prevent future damage and costly repairs.
